Small Businesses are Big Players on the Web

A recent research report which was aimed at determining the state of small business website and online advertising spending points out…

America’s 14.6 million small and medium-sized businesses (SMBs) were responsible for more than $6.7 billion in locally generated, locally targeted interactive advertising in 2008 – more than half of the US total, according to a recently released report from Borrell Associates, which predicts these numbers will grow significantly as activities continue to shift online.

Here is the kicker, many Marketers don’t understand about small businesses though. The report also indicated more than two-thirds of them were allocating their online advertising expenditures on advancing their own websites rather than online ads per say.

Being a web professional for many years now I say this is a smart business move on the part of small businesses. Your web presence is one of the most valuable assets you have in business today no matter what size your business is.
